ESF Hosts Town Halls to Address Questions Regarding 2020-21 Academic Year 7/22/2020
SHARE:The SUNY College of Environmental Science and Forestry (ESF) has scheduled several virtual town halls to address the many questions people have regarding the 2020-21 academic year.
Knowing that not all groups have the same questions and concerns, the town halls are designed for four audiences: new students; new parent/family; returning student/parent-family; and faculty and staff. Each session will address a different area of concern.
New student sessions will be held on Instagram Live (@suny.esf) at 7 p.m. Dates and topics are:
July 16: Fall checklist
July 23: Centennial Hall and meal plans
Aug. 6: Office of Inclusion, Diversity and Equity (OIDE) and affinity groups
Aug. 13: Student Life
New parent/family/guardian sessions will be held on Facebook Live (facebook.com/sunyesf) at 7 p.m. Dates and topics are:
July 21: Academic information
July 28: Centennial Hall, meal plans, social distancing
Aug. 4: Student Life, Diversity and Inclusion; financial aid
Returning student, parent/family/guardian sessions will be held Wednesdays on ESFTV (youtube.com/esftv)
July 15: Academics: Fall 2020
Aug. 5: Student Life: Fall 2020 at 11 a.m.
Aug. 5: Finances (CARES Act, financial aid, fees, etc.) at 7 p.m.
Aug. 12: Health and Safety at 11 a.m.
Faculty and staff sessions will be held on ESFTV. The town hall scheduled for August 19 to discuss the College's financial situation has been postponed. We expect it will be rescheduled in September.
All town halls that are being presented via ESFTV are available to watch at your leisure. Please visit youtube.com and search for ESFTV.
